如何判断CCSprite上的一个触摸点是否是透明区域?

我创建了一个自定义的CCSprite,然后添加了一张png图片。
CCTexture2D *paddleTexture = [[CCTextureCache sharedTextureCache] addImage:@"1.png"];
        
MySprite *mSprite = [MySprite paddleWithTexture:paddleTexture];

当手指触摸到这个CCSprite时,我该如何判断当前触摸的位置是否是在图片上的透明区域,还是在图片的图像上。
请高手们帮帮忙,谢谢



备注:
//判断触摸点是否在CCSprite上
- (BOOL)containsTouchLocation:(UITouch *)touch
{
    CGPoint p = [self convertTouchToNodeSpaceAR:touch];
    CGRect r = [self rectInPixels];
    
    return CGRectContainsPoint(r, p);
}


====解决方案如下================================

CGImageRef inImage;

调用getPixelColorAtLocation方法,传入图片上的一个点,根据返回值判断是否透明区域(如果返回值为0则表示是透明区域)

- (int)getPixelColorAtLocation:(CGPoint)point 
{
    
    CGContextRef cgctx = [self createARGBBitmapContextFromImage];
    if (cgctx == NULL) { return -1; /* error */ }
    
    size_t w = CGImageGetWidth(inImage);
    size_t h = CGImageGetHeight(inImage);
    
    CGRect rect = {{0,0},{w,h}}; 
    
    CGContextDrawImage(cgctx, rect, inImage); 
    
    unsigned char* data = CGBitmapContextGetData (cgctx);
    
    int alpha;
    if (data != NULL) {
        
        @try {
            int offset = 4*((w*round(point.y))+round(point.x));
            
            alpha =  data[offset]; 
           
        }
        @catch (NSException * e) {
                    }
        @finally {
            
        }
        
    }
    
    
    CGContextRelease(cgctx); 
    
    if (data) { free(data); }
    
    return alpha;
}

- (CGContextRef)createARGBBitmapContextFromImage
{
    
    CGContextRef    context = NULL;
    CGColorSpaceRef colorSpace;
    void *          bitmapData;
    int             bitmapByteCount;
    int             bitmapBytesPerRow;
    
    size_t pixelsWide = CGImageGetWidth(inImage);
    size_t pixelsHigh = CGImageGetHeight(inImage);
    
    bitmapBytesPerRow   = (pixelsWide * 4);
    bitmapByteCount     = (bitmapBytesPerRow * pixelsHigh);
    
    colorSpace = CGColorSpaceCreateDeviceRGB();
    if (colorSpace == NULL)
        return nil;
    
    bitmapData = malloc( bitmapByteCount );
    if (bitmapData == NULL)
    {
        CGColorSpaceRelease( colorSpace );
        return nil;
    }
    
    context = CGBitmapContextCreate (bitmapData,
                                     pixelsWide,
                                     pixelsHigh,
                                     8,
                                     bitmapBytesPerRow,
                                     colorSpace,
                                     kCGImageAlphaPremultipliedFirst|kCGBitmapByteOrder32Big);
    
    if (context == NULL)
    {
        free (bitmapData);
        fprintf (stderr, "Context not created!");
    }
    
    CGColorSpaceRelease( colorSpace );
    
    CGContextSetBlendMode(context, kCGBlendModeCopy);
    
    return context;
}
